Inter ready to pounce on Porto midfielder

Share this with Email Share this with Facebook Share this with Twitter Share this with Whatsapp

Mexican international Hector Herrera wants to leave Portuguese giants FC Porto and Inter are considering the idea of bringing him to the Italian peninsula.

The 28-year-old has one year left on his contract with Os Dragoes and he has refused to sign a contract renewal, which has drawn the attention of the Nerazzurri.

La Gazzetta dello Sport report that Herrera could be purchased from Porto for €20 million this summer and Inter tactician Luciano Spalletti is interested having the Dragoes midfielder in the squad.

Spalletti recalls when he coached Roma in 2016-17 and Porto eliminated the Giallorossi 4-1 on aggregate in the Champions League play-offs. The Mexican international provided two assists in the second leg, which the Portuguese giants won 3-0 at the Stadio Olimpico in Rome.

Herrera has played 192 competitive matches for Porto, scoring 26 goals and providing 32 assists since he joined the club in 2013.
